What is a Ceiling Channel Roll Forming Machine?


A ceiling channel roll forming machine is designed to produce ceiling channels — thin metal strips, typically made of galvanized steel or other alloys — that are used to support ceilings and other lightweight structures. The machine works by feeding flat metal sheets into a series of rollers that progressively shape the material into a desired profile. This automated process not only streamlines production but also ensures uniformity and consistency in the final product.


Key Features and Components


1. Roller Die Set The heart of the roll forming machine consists of a set of rollers, carefully designed to create the specific profile of the ceiling channel. These rollers are often made from high-strength materials to withstand continuous operation.


2. Feed Mechanism The feed system typically includes a magnetic or servo-driven feeder that controls the speed and alignment of the metal sheet as it enters the machine. This precision is vital for achieving the correct dimensions and reducing material waste.


3. Cutoff Mechanism Once the metal has been rolled into the desired shape, it needs to be cut to size. Integrated cutoff mechanisms, often featuring hydraulic or mechanical blades, ensure that each piece is cut accurately according to specified lengths.


4. Control System Modern ceiling channel roll forming machines are equipped with advanced control systems that allow operators to adjust parameters such as speed, pressure, and temperature. Many units offer digital displays and programmable features for increased ease of use.


5. Safety Features Given the high speeds and forces involved in the roll forming process, safety is a top priority. Machines are typically fitted with emergency stop buttons, guarding mechanisms, and sensors to protect operators from accidents.

Benefits of Using a Ceiling Channel Roll Forming Machine


The adoption of ceiling channel roll forming machines brings several compelling advantages to manufacturers


- High Production Efficiency These machines can produce large volumes of ceiling channels in a short period, significantly reducing labor costs and production time. - Precision Engineering The precise nature of roll forming allows for the creation of consistent and high-quality products that meet industry standards.


- Cost-Effectiveness By minimizing material waste through accurate shaping and cutting, companies can achieve significant cost savings.


- Versatility Many roll forming machines can be adjusted to produce various profiles and specifications, making them suitable for multiple applications within the construction industry.


- Enhanced Durability Products formed through this process typically exhibit increased strength and resilience, which is crucial for structural applications.


Applications of Ceiling Channels


Ceiling channels are widely used in construction, particularly in commercial and residential buildings. They serve as support systems for suspended ceilings, providing a framework that holds ceiling tiles and other materials securely. Additionally, their use extends to wall partitions, ductwork, and other lightweight structural frameworks.
